Where to update arrival time?

We arrive tomorrow and I just got an email from Disney and it says my arrival time is midnight. I don’t recall ever putting in a time. I am using Disney Express and they know I arrive at 11:30am.

it says to go to my Disney experience to update on line check in. I have liked and looked and don’t see where I put i ln arrival times. Anyone know?
 
Assuming you have put the reservation in MyDisneyExperience, go to MDW, sign in, under MyDisneyExperience go to My Plans, and then where your reservation is shown there should be a tab saying either "Modify Check-in," or, if you have not done it yet, "Check-in," Click on that and on the next page that comes up, click on either "Show" or "Details" and one of the things listed that can be added or modified will be "Your Resort Arrival" time.

Have you already done online check-in?
We did on a previous stay and the default arrival time is midnight. You have to scroll down to actually see the arrival time section and then can choose a different time. I think it is a terrible system to have the default be midnight. We were doing a split stay, and when we went to our second resort about 5:00pm and asked when our room would be ready they told us it was ready. I then asked why we had not received a room ready text, and they said even though our room was ready, the texts do not go out until a few hours before the scheduled arrival time and that is when I found out our scheduled arrival time was midnight.
I asked why our scheduled arrival time showed as midnight when I had not seen a place to enter an expected arrival time when I did online check-in earler that morning. It was only then I found out that you need to scroll down when doing online check-in to enter your expected arrival time and if you don't go to that section and change it, the default will be midnight.
It would seem better if there was no default, and if you did not enter an estimated arrival time when you first submited your online check-in you would get an error message that said please enter an estimated arrival time and resubmit. However, it is Disney IT.

It defaults to that for DME and can not be changed. It just means you won’t get the text until you get there to let them know you have arrived.
